Introduction

Johnny (1980) is a Tamil-language action drama film directed by Mahendran and produced by A. S. R. Anjaneyulu. The film stars Rajinikanth in the title role, with Sujatha, Shubha, Vinu Chakravarthy, and Chandramohan playing significant supporting roles. Known for its emotional depth and gripping narrative, Johnny marked a pivotal moment in Rajinikanth's career, showcasing his versatility as an actor. The film mixes action, drama, and social issues, making it a memorable cinematic experience.

Music and Cinematography

  • Music by Ilaiyaraaja:
    The soundtrack of Johnny, composed by Ilaiyaraaja, is one of the highlights of the film. The songs are memorable, with a mix of soulful melodies and energetic tracks. Ilaiyaraaja’s background score complements the emotional and action sequences, amplifying the drama and intensity. Tracks like “Aasaiya Kaathula” became quite popular and are still remembered fondly by fans.
